Directions From the border of Costa Rica:
First, make sure you have the necessary
paperwork for the car before heading for the border. If you
are not sure of the current laws, its a good idea to call the US embassy and
they can direct you in the right direction.
Head north from Liberia, Costa Rica toward the border on the Pan-American highway (aka the Costanera).
Once you have crossed the border into Nicaragua continue north to the
town of Rivas about 30 minutes away and is the
next major city past San Juan Del Sur.
In Rivas, pass the Texaco and look
for a road sign for TOLA. While driving towards TOLA, "Rancho
Santana" signs will lead you in the right direction, until you eventually pass the ranch's white archway entrance
along the left side of the road.
Once in Tola, come to the Police station and
make a left, go three blocks and make a right at the sign that says "Rancho
Santana" you should now be on a dirt road. After you follow the
dirt road for some time the dirt road eventually widens & there is one fork
that you could easily follow to the right, in the wrong direction. Make sure
you make a left here. This should be about 15 kilometers after TOLA (could be
twenty minutes to an hour depending
on the roads). This turn is after Rancho Santana and Hotel Iguana entrances
another few kilometers down the road.
Once there, you will come to a fork in the
road that goes up a hill and over a bridge to your left at the
Bar La Tica. Make a left onto this road and go over the bridge. The road is paved
just ahead. Relax,
your here. Follow for
two miles and when the road hugs around a large rancho on the left, you made
it!
